Demand and penalty-initiation notices cannot rest on an order expressly issued as a draft assessment order. Where proposed disallowances remain proposals, no demand or penalty notice is issued, and the taxpayer retains the right to accept variations or object before final assessment, the payable sum has not been finally determined. Such a defect is not a mere uploading error curable through Section 292B, especially without a subsequent corrective or clarificatory order. Draft assessment procedure is also unavailable where the Transfer Pricing Officer makes no variation to returned income from international transactions; the taxpayer is then not an eligible assessee under Section 144C. The draft order and consequential notices were set aside.
